On July 12, several notable moments in the history of News stand out. In 1754, Thomas Bowdler, English physician and philanthropist (died 1825) was born. In 1915, Leonard Goodwin, British protozoologist (died 2008) was born. In 1943, Howard Gardner, American psychologist and academic was born. In 1947, Norman Lebrecht, English author and critic was born. In 1953, Leon Spinks, American boxer (died 2021) was born. In 1955, Balaji Sadasivan, Singaporean neurosurgeon and politician, Singaporean Minister of Health (died 2010) was born. In 1962, Project Apollo: At a press conference, NASA announces lunar orbit rendezvous as the means to land astronauts on the Moon, and return them to Earth. In 1984, Yorman Bazardo, Venezuelan baseball player was born. In 1993, Rebecca Bross, American gymnast was born. In 2015, Joaquín "El Chapo" Guzmán escapes from the maximum security Altiplano prison in Mexico, his second escape. A new review published June 30, 2026, found creatine may add benefit when paired with depression treatment in some patients. But trials were small and evidence remains preliminary.
